Data Analyst/oracle Pl /sql Developer Resume
Albany, NY
SUMMARY
- 7 + years of experience in Oracle, SQL and PL/SQL involving database design, application development, implementation, quality testing, statistical analysis, and support.
- Involved in database design and data modeling to create ER diagram and database objects.
- Proficient in writing stored and application procedures, packages, database triggers and functions using PL/SQL.
- Fundamental understanding of materialized views, replication, and external tables
- Experience of complete Software Development lifecycle (SDLC) process
- Utilized oracle advance features like Bulk Bind (Bulk collect, For all), Ref Cursor, and Index - By Tables.
- Experience in quality testing of data-warehouse objects, using a customized scripts based on in-house methodology.
- Experience in maintaining and developing database objects like tables, views, indexes, sequences, synonyms etc
- Experience in tuning complex SQL statements using Explain plan and SQL trace
- Experience in utilizing oracle analytical and decoding functions and dealing wif multi-terabytes database
- Experience and noledge of FTP transfer from UNIX to Windows and vice versa
- Developed Interactive User Interfaces using Forms 6i/9i and generated reports using Reports 6i
- Experience in writing Shell (Korn, Bash, C) and AWK scripts and have utilized crontab functionality
- Experience utilizing dynamic SQL (dbms sql, Execute Immediate) functionality
- Generated Excel Reports using oracle supplied package UTL FILE for data analysis purpose
- Knowledge and experience of Data Analysis, Data Warehousing, and ETL Techniques
- Conceptual understanding of Data marts, OLAP, OLTP, STAR Schema, and Snowflake schema
- Expertise in Oracle 10g/9i/8i database server, forms 6i/9i and reports 6i/9i, and tools like SQL Plus, SQL Developer, TOAD, Data Loader, SQL * Loader, and RapidSQL.
- Experience and noledge of HTML, CSS, and JavaScript
- Good understanding of data mining concepts, ETL processes, and data modeling concepts such as design of the dataflow, ER Diagrams, Normalization and Denormalization of tables
- Involved in unit testing, functional testing, system testing, data validation, and user acceptance testing
- Strong Inter-personal, analytical, and problem-solving skills wif proven ability to deliver excellent results in competitive environment
TECHNICAL SKILLS
Database: Oracle 12c/11g/10g/9i/8i
Programming Languages: PL/SQL, SQL HTML, CSS, DHTML, Shell Scripting
Tools: Toad,Sql Developer,sqlplus
Operating Systems: Windows XP, 2000, VISTA, UNIX (Solaris, HP, AIX), LINUX
Communication tools: MS Outlook, Lotus Notes
PROFESSIONAL EXPERIENCE
Confidential, Albany, NY
Data Analyst/Oracle Pl /Sql Developer
Responsibilities:
- Attend meetings wif Business users and gather project requirements, convert business requirements into technical design, coding using PL/SQL programming language
- Involve in creating various database objects like Tables, Views, Materialized Views, Procedures, Packages and Indexes.
- Use DBMS SCHEDULER to schedule the jobs and monitor them on daily basis
- Use tools like Toad and PL/SQL and Oracle 12c database to write complex SQL queries
- Involve in programming Views, Procedures and Packages
- Work wif different teams like Data Administrators, Application Developers, Infrastructure and Networking teams to deploy the code and troubleshoot
- Involve in Data Analysis and Data profiling
- Perform code migration from development to stage to production
- Handle production support tickets using JIRA as tracking tool
Environment: Toad 12, PL/SQL Developer, Notepad++, Oracle 12c, JIRA.
Confidential, Greensboro, NC
Data Analyst/Oracle Developer
Responsibilities:
- Worked wif Tech lead, Business analyst, Responsible in gathering Requirements and IT review. Interacted wif Business Users in the design of technical specification documents.
- Tuning code, reviewing tables and applying indexes where needed.
- Analyse, design, code, and test highly efficient and highly scalable integration solutions using Informatica suite of products· Analyze the requirements, target and source data
- Production Support based for all HUBDI/HUBODS/SOLR(AWD,ECS1,ECS2)
- Involved in Data analysis and Data profiling
- Used Soup UI for Testing the DATA and to make a keen analysis on the raw data by generating the Test suite.
- TOAD, SQL Developer tools were used to develop programs and executing the queries.
Environment: Toad 12, SQL developer, Unix, Putty, Notepad++,Oracle 10g/11g/12c,JIRA.
Confidential, Winston Salem, NC
Senior Oracle PL/SQL Developer
Responsibilities:
- Interacted wif BA’s and the DBA’s to analyze the issues dat were encountered while testing the applications.
- Involved in Data analysis and Data profiling.
- Responsible to validate the data between the various systems and drive changes dat ensure the integrity based on Business Rules and Transformations.
- Involved in reading and analyzing the data mapping documents.
- Strong ability in developing advanced SQL queries to extract and calculate information to fulfill data and reporting requirements .
- Used the Toad Data Analyst to compare the results between the Source and the Target .
- Used the ALM tool to write the test cases and to track the defects.
- Extensively worked wif Excel advanced commands for preparing and comparing the data.
- Developed ETL’s for data extraction, Data mapping and Data Conversion using SQL, PL/SQL.
- Performed system testing, functional testing and Integration testing and the regression testing.
Environment: Toad 12, SQL developer, Unix, Putty, Notepad++, Oracle 10g/11g,ALM12.0
Confidential, Utica, NY
Senior Oracle PL/SQL Developer
Responsibilities:
- Involved in Data Analysis, and Design the Process flows in the more efficient way tan earlier flows.
- Worked individually in developing the Procedures, Functions, Cursors, Complex Queries and Performed Data loading using ORACLE ODI (oracle data Integrator).
- Experience in using Dynamic SQL's, BULK COLLECT, REF Cursors and VARRAYS and Collections..
- To develop Test Plan and participate in UNIT testing and System Integration Testing for Production Implementation.
- Involve in Unit testing PL/ SQL Stored Procedures and Functions.
- Used Soup UI for Testing the DATA and to make a keen analysis on the raw data by generating the Test suite.
- Fine-tuned the SQL queries using Explain Plan.
- TOAD, SQL Developer tools were used to develop programs and executing the queries.
- Extensively wrote SQL Queries (Sub queries, correlated sub queries and Join conditions) for generating various kinds of reports as per the user requirement.
- Provided support for the application database related issues.
- Involved in reports designing and developing. Involved in integrated reporting capability.
- Developed various reports using oracle reports builder 6i and upgrades the existing reports .
- Developed the Stored procedures using PL/ SQL Tables and records to generate the output in XML format.
- Involved in the data analysis and data discrepancy reduction for the source and target schemas.
- Involved in writing Oracle PL/SQL packages, functions, procedures, Korn Shell scripts dat were used for staging, transformation and loading of the data into base tables.
- Provided support for the application database related issues.
- Involved in coding, debugging, and trouble-shooting.
- TOAD, SQL Developer tools were used to develop programs and executing the queries.
- Developed forms using forms 6i based on business requirements.
- Worked wif SQL Query performance issues. Used index logic to obtain the good performance.
Environment: Oracle 10/11g, Rapid SQL, Edit Plus, SQL Plus, SQL, PL/SQL, UNIX (HP), Shell (Bash) Script, Windows XP, LINUX, Soup UI
Confidential, Greensboro,NC
Senior Oracle PL/SQL Developer
Responsibilities:
- Involved in creating Oracle tables, views, procedures, packages, triggers, functions and indexes.
- Designed star schema using dimensional modeling and created fact tables and dimensional tables.
- Manipulated large amount of data.
- Extensively wrote SQL queries for generating various kinds of reports as per the usual requirement.
- Debugged SQL and provided alternate ways to write SQL for DB performance improvements.
- TOAD, SQL Developer tools were used to develop programs and executing the queries.
- Developed forms using forms 6i based on business requirements.
- Worked wif SQL Query performance issues. Used index logic to obtain the good performance.
- Involved in the monitoring of database performance in Enterprise Manger console.
- Studied user requirements and functional specifications.
- Converted User Requirements into formal Functional specification and Interfacing wif client.
Environment: Oracle 10/11g, Rapid SQL, Edit Plus, SQL Plus, SQL, PL/SQL, UNIX (HP), Shell (Bash) Script, Windows XP, LINUX, Soup UI
Confidential, Hoover,Alabama
Senior Oracle PL/SQL Developer
Responsibilities:
- Involved in designing, developing, and testing of PL/SQL stored procedures, packages and triggers.
- Developed complex SQL and PL/SQL queries.
- Created database objects like Tables, views, synonyms, Indexes etc
- Extensively wrote SQL Queries (Sub queries, correlated sub queries and Join conditions) for generating various kinds of reports as per the user requirement.
- Used Informatica Designer (Power Mart) to create complex Mappings
- Developed several Informatica mappings dat transfers data from source the Data Mart.
- Created Source definitions, Source Tables, Target definitions and Target Tables.
- Used Informatica Server Manager to create sessions/ batches to run wif the logic embedded in the
- Involved in writing Oracle PL/SQL packages, functions, procedures, Korn Shell scripts dat were used for staging, transformation and loading of the data into base tables.
- Provided support for the application database related issues.
- Used Erwin for designing Database both logical and physical data modeling.
- TOAD, SQL Developer tools were used to develop programs and executing the queries.
- Developed forms using forms 6i based on business requirements.
- Worked wif SQL Query performance issues. Used index logic to obtain the good performance.
- Involved in the monitoring of database performance in Enterprise Manger console.
- Studied user requirements and functional specifications.
- Converted User Requirements into formal Functional specification and Interfacing wif client
Environment: Oracle 10/11g, Rapid SQL, Edit Plus, Perforce, WinScp, SQL Plus, SQL, PL/SQL, UNIX (HP), Shell (Bash) Script, AWK, SQL * Loader, Windows XP, LINUX, Erwin, Informatica Power Center 9.1
Confidential
Oracle PL/SQL Developer
Responsibilities:
- Studied user requirements and functional specifications.
- Converted User Requirements into formal Functional specification and Interfacing wif client.
- Designed, Partitioned, Developed and Maintained the necessary database objects
- Participated in implementation meeting strategies.
- Involved in developing Entity Relationship diagrams/Dimensional Diagrams for business requirements using ERWIN.
- Designed and developed Oracle Forms & Reports using Forms10g and Reports 10g. Including Forms based on stored procedures.
- Developed ETL’s for Data Extraction, Data Mapping and data Conversion using SQL, PL/SQL and various shell scripts in Data stage.
- Involved in writing Oracle PL/SQL functions, procedures and packages in Oracle RAC environment.
- Written Bash Shell scripts dat were used for staging, transformation and loading of the data into base tables.
- Enhancing the existing packages for better performance and providing on-going support to existing applications and troubleshooting serious errors when occurred.
- Used Bulk processing for performance enhancement.
- Created UNIX shell scripts using SQL*Loader, SQL*Plus and PL/SQL programs dat run as nightly interfaces.
- Was responsible for development and testing of conversion programs for importing data from text files into Oracle database utilizing SQL *Loader.
Environment: Oracle 10g/11g, PL/SQL, SQL Plus, Erwin 7.3,SQL Navigator, XML, Shell Scripting, SQL*Loader, Shell Scripting, SQL developer, Reports 10g/6i,CSS, DBMS JOB,UTL FILE,UNIX.
Confidential
Oracle PL/SQL Developer
Responsibilities:
- Created the database Objects such as Tables, Views, Indexes, constraints .
- Involved in Development, Testing and Maintenance database objects.
- Developed the forms for the application and developed Procedures and functions at application level.
- Created the Stored Procedures, functions and Packages using PL/SQL.
- Oracle PL/SQL functions, procedures, Korn Shell scripts were used for staging, transformation and loading of the data into base tables
- Performed data loading using Data Loader to the data into staging tables.
- Created PL/SQL procedures in order to dump the data from staging tables to base tables
- Scheduled the jobs using crontab in UNIX.
- Developed a framework to establish procedure exception or job failure and alerted via email configuration.
- Responsible for developing reports as per Customers order using reports
- Developed Customer transaction upload module to load data into database from flat file wif business validation (Package, Procedures & Triggers are used).
- Worked closely wif quality assurance and development teams to clarify and understand the functionality to resolve issues and provide feedback in terms of the test matrices and to nail down the bugs.
- Involved during User Acceptance Testing of the application.
Environment: TOAD, Data Loader, AUTOSYS SQL*Plus, PL/SQL, Windows NT server, UNIX.